The Real Reasons Tree Trimming Matters in Bakersfield and Kern County

Trimming makes a visible difference today, but it also helps prevent the problems that tend to show up later.
Check Icon

Reduce the Risk of Falling Limbs

Overgrown limbs can drop without warning, especially after weeks of dry heat or a sudden wind gust. Targeted pruning removes weak, cracked, or rubbing branches before they fail. The result is a canopy that feels steadier, safer, and easier to live around.

Check Icon

Maintain Safe Clearance for Trees

Branches that creep over roofs, driveways, or walkways slowly turn into daily annoyances and future repairs. Proper clearance trimming protects structures, improves sightlines, and keeps parking and pathways usable. It also reduces debris buildup in gutters and in tight corners year-round.

Check Icon

Support Healthier Growth

Trees need breathing room. When growth becomes crowded, stress builds, and performance drops. Thoughtful trimming improves airflow and sunlight through the canopy, helping the tree put energy where it matters. Over time, this supports stronger growth and fewer problem limbs every year.

Check Icon

Improve Curb Appeal

Great trimming should look natural, not “overdone.” By removing what’s necessary and leaving what’s strong, pruning cleans up the silhouette and highlights the tree’s shape. You get a sharper landscape without sacrificing shade, structure, or future growth, the way it should be.

Check Icon

Create Manageable Outdoor Space

When trees sprawl, outdoor areas feel smaller. Pruning opens up space, reduces heavy overhang, and restores usable light. Many clients notice the difference immediately, as if the yard can finally breathe again. Maintenance becomes simpler week after week for busy households.

More Than “Cutting It Back”: A Strategic Approach to Tree Trimming That Gets Better Results

We use proven techniques with a clear purpose, so your trees stay safer, healthier, and easier to maintain.
Check Icon

Ornamental Pruning

Ornamental pruning keeps your landscape looking intentional and well-balanced. We refine shape, remove crossing growth, and clean up dead or weak twigs without forcing unnatural lines. It’s ideal for entryways, focal trees, and properties where presentation matters.

Check Icon

Lacing and Shaping

Lacing and shaping reduces z/density inside the canopy while preserving the tree’s natural outline. By selectively thinning, we improve airflow and light, which helps the tree handle heat and wind better. The canopy looks lighter, not stripped or sparse, during tough summers.

Check Icon

Crown Reduction

Crown reduction is used when a tree has outgrown its space or when its weight needs to be reduced. We shorten targeted limbs back to suitable laterals, keeping the crown strong and stable. It’s a responsible alternative to harsh cutting or topping when needed.

Check Icon

Structural Pruning for Young Trees

Structural pruning guides young trees into a healthier form before small issues become big ones. We encourage strong branch spacing and reduce competing leaders early. That planning pays off later with better stability, fewer weak attachments, and a canopy that matures well naturally.

Check Icon

Deadwooding and Hazard Mitigation

Deadwooding removes dead, dying, or brittle limbs that can fall at the worst time. We focus on hazards first, then clean the canopy for a safer, healthier look. It also reduces the chance of decay spreading into stronger wood over time.

When Tree Trimming Is Most Helpful

The right timing depends on your goals, your tree’s condition, and what the season is doing to it.
Some property owners schedule trimming regularly, while others wait until a tree becomes a problem. In general, trimming is often most helpful when done before the canopy becomes too dense, too heavy, or too close to structures. Small issues are easier to correct early, and the results tend to hold up better.

Consider scheduling trimming when:
  • Branches are close to the roofline
  • Visibility is obstructed
  • Dead or damaged wood is visible
  • The canopy looks uneven after storms or strong winds
